sql2008附加高版本数据库|sql SERVER2008 R2提示附加数据库时版本为661此服务器支持655版本

|

1. 低版本数据库怎样附加高版本的数据库

可以使用脚本来导出数据库的所有数据,然后去生成点击完成就可以了,在低版本的服务器上先建立一个空的数据库,最后把生成的数据库脚本执行。

2. sql server 2008附加数据库是出错 sql server 2008数据库附加的是sql server 2008数据库版本错误高版本到低

SQL2008有两个版本,分别是2008(10.0)和2008R2(10.5)。高版本文件无法附加在低版本上。需要你升级的2008R2再附加。

3. sql2008如何附加高版本的数据库 我现在只有08的数据库 求高手帮转换下 求帮助 在线等

将原数据库分离后——复制数据文件到本地(实际目标磁盘)——然后使用本地数据库就行附加至本地

4. SQL2008数据库怎么附加数据库 SQL附加数据库方法步骤

首先从开始菜单着手,打开开始菜单栏,在菜单栏上找到我们已经安装的SQL server 2008,单击打开它打开SQL server 2008数据库,来到登录界面,在这里我们只需要输入登录服务器名(电脑IP地址)、登录身份、账号、密码,然后单击登录注意:我们用的是SQL身份登录,这里还可以选择windows身份登录,权限会更大成功登录进入SQL 数据库,可以看到连接的数据库基本信息,展开数据库结点,单击数据库然后使用鼠标右键,在弹出的菜单中选择附加接着弹出附加数据库的界面,这里我们只需要单击界面上的添加按钮就可以了单击添加按钮后,新弹出来一个框,让你选择你要附加的数据文件路径,选择到我们要附加的数据库文件,单击确定按钮注意:我们一帮都会要附加的数据库文件放在SQL数据库的安装目录下,这样才能避免有时候附加出来的数据库是只读状态的问题返回到附加数据库的界面,这是我们可以从界面上看到选择的附加数据库文件信息,然后在上方可以修改要附加的数据库名称(红色框出来部分)单击确定按钮后,数据库的附加功能就启动了,这时候我们可以从界面上看到附加的进度,如图所示附加成功后,附加数据库的界面窗口会关闭,然后我们可以从左边的树形菜单看到已经附加完成的数据库注意事项附加数据库的功能类似还原数据库,只是它使用的是mdf文件,还原数据库使用的是备份文件更多相关内容可参考资料http://www.viiboo.cn

5. sql 2008的数据库怎么附加到sql2005数据库里面

不能直接完成这样的任务。高版本的文件不能被低版本的SQL正常识别使用。可以试着在SQL2008中导出数据库构架的脚本后,在SQL2005中生成空数据库,然后再把数据导过去。数据库不多的数据库可以直接导出成脚本后,在SQL2005中直接生成。具体方法如下:一、最简单的回答:1、利用脚本来实现。2、存在大量数据的数据库,比如数据库中存在记录数过万条的数据表,实现起来可能非常慢,且可能出错,没法进行下去。二、SQL Server2008数据导入到SQL Server2005具体方法:1、打开SQL Server2008“对象资源管理器”;2、右击数据库,如:cadERP的数据库,选择“任务”–“生成脚本”;3、打开生成和脚本发生窗口后点击“下一步”;4、进入“选择特定数据库对象”,选择“全选”表–“下一步”;5、进入“设置脚本编写选项”,选择“高级”–找到“为服务器版本编写脚本”项选择“SQL Server 2005”–“下一步”完成;6、此时打开SQL Server2005,创建一个和SQL2008生成的脚本文件名相同的数据库,选择“新建查询”,把SQL2008生成的脚本文件直接拖到新建查询窗口中,执行“F5”。这个时候SQL Server2005中的数据和SQL Server2008中的数据就完全相同啦。三、其后又出了SQL2008R2相对SQL2005来说,没有根本性的改动,基本全兼容于2005版,只在可靠性、成熟度上作了很大的改进,所以,如果可能,直接用SQL2008代替SQL2005,是最好的办法。

6. sql server 2008 r2 怎么附加数据库

提示已经有相同的数据库 说明当前2008上有个数据库和你的一样,你需要先删了那个库,或对那个库进行改名。你检查下,是哪个操作显示该数据库正在使用?这个我理解还是上面的问题。

7. SQL2008怎么附加SQL2008R2的数据库

附加不了。只能在SQL2008R2生成2008的脚本,然后在2008执行脚本具体过程是SQL Server 2008 R2导出的过程1.打开回Management Studio,登录到服务器,在数据答库中选择要转移的数据库,右键--“任务(T)”--“生成脚本(E)…”。2.在“生成和发布脚本”窗口中,点击“下一步”,3.“选择要编写脚本的数据库对象”,可以不做设置,点击“下一步”,4.点击[保存到文件]右边的“高级”按钮,在对话框中,设置“为服务器版本编写脚本”为“SQL Server 2008”,设置“要编写脚本的数据的类型”为“架构和数据”。选择保存脚本的位置。5.下一步,再下一步。导出完成。SQL Server 2008导入的过程1.打开Management Studio,登录到服务器,2.选择菜单“文件”——“打开”——“文件”,选择.sql脚本文件,点击工具栏中的“执行”按钮。3.在左侧的“对象资源管理器”中右键“数据库”——“刷新”。完毕

8. sql SERVER2008 R2提示附加数据库时,版本为661,此服务器支持655版本

版本号661是SQL Server 2008 R2,版本号655是SQL Server 2008 等。它拥有向上兼容的特点。由此可见,标题的意思就是说,你要附加的数据库,只能在SQL Server 2008 R2及更高版本上运行,不能在SQL Server 2008 上运行,那么,我们该怎么处理这个问题呢?处理这种问题,有很多种方法,下面我就说一个我查到并使用的方法,仅供参考,如果有更好的方法,欢迎沟通。 1.把这个数据库附加到装有SQL Server 2008 R2的数据上。 2.打开Management Studio,登录到服务器,在数据库中选择要转移的数据库,右键--“任务(T)”--“生成脚本(E)…”。 3.在“生成和发布脚本”窗口中,点击“下一步” 4.“选择要编写脚本的数据库对象”,可以不做设置,点击“下一步” 5.点击[保存到文件]右边的“高级”按钮,在对话框中,设置“为服务器版本编写脚本”为“SQL Server 2008”,设置“要编写脚本的数据的类型”为“架构和数据”。选择保存脚本的位置 6.下一步,再下一步。导出完成把导出完成的程序,在放到SQL Server 2008 中,按下面步骤: 1.打开Management Studio,登录到服务器 2.选择菜单“文件”——“打开”——“文件”,选择.sql脚本文件,点击工具栏中的“执行”按钮 3.在左侧的“对象资源管理器”中右键“数据库”——“刷新” 到此为止,“版本号661,无法打开,支持655版本及其以下版本……”这个错误就算是解决了。当然,如果你直接把数据库卸载,在装SQL Server 2008R2 , 也是可以完美解决这个问题的。

9. 在SQL server 2008怎么附加数据库文件

楼主好。首先说说附加数据库是怎么回事,附加数据库只的是移植的数据库文件(非.bak)的内备份文件,从一容台服务器或者电脑上移植到另外一个服务器电脑的过程,就是附加。附加要满足如下条件才能够附加。首先是需要取得数据库文件在需要附加的windows系统的完全权限,即完全控制。第二是由于数据库只支持向下兼容,所以,高版本的数据库文件是不能够附加在低版本的数据库上面的。如12版本的数据库文件是没办法附加在08版本上的。在第一个条件中,如果没有获取到完全控制权限,也很简单,右键单击你移植过来的数据库文件,安全选项卡中,选择对应的windows账户,然后勾选完全控制即可。注意的是日志和数据库文件均需要取得完全控制。接下来就是附加,连接好数据库引擎之后,右键单击数据库文件夹,选择附加功能,然后浏览你移植到本地的数据库文件即可。


赞 (0)